Physician - Family Medicine - Stoughton, WI
Family Medicine | WI-SSM Health Dean Medical Group Stoughton | Stoughton, WI | Req #: R142775

Presence is exceptional care that delivers exceptional outcomes. We would like to invite you to share that gift as part of the Family Medicine team at SSM Health Dean Medical Group in Stoughton, Wisconsin.

We are seeking a collaborative, engaged, & committed physician who has a proven ability to engage with their colleagues & patients, and who shares our dedication to exceptional care & outcomes.

The Opportunity:

  • Outpatient only practice with hours ranging from Monday-Friday, 7 am - 5 pm
  • Schedule options ranging from 4, 4 1/2, or 5 days/week
  • Option of choosing 1.0, .9, or .8 fte, all full time status
  • On-call is phone call only, ~2-3 weekends/year & 6-7 weeknights/year
  • 28 -36 pt. contact hours depending on fte & appointment template chosen
  • 2-year salary guarantee with generous sign-on bonus
  • Comprehensive benefit package exclusively designed for physicians including annual CME dollars, immediate vacation/CME, & 401K multi-funded retirement account

The Community:

  • Stoughton https://livability.com/wi/stoughton/ is a thriving, family-oriented community of over 12,000, offering excellent schools & abundant recreational opportunities
  • Less than 20 miles from Madison, which is known for its high tech business, acclaimed academic institutions, idyllic lakes, expansive walking & biking paths, recreational trails, farmers markets, & more
  • Lower cost of living & reasonable housing prices
  • From playing golf, hiking, & snowmobiling to cross country skiing, there is something for everyone to enjoy

Collectively, SSM Health and the other Catholic health organizations that have signed the pledge employ nearly a half million people across 46 states and the District of Columbia, and care for almost four million patients annually.

Recognizing that racism is an affront to the core values of Catholic social teaching, CHA members joined in solidarity to promote the common good and seek justice by being actively anti-racist and accountable in effecting positive change in the communities we serve.

Four focus areas

Act for COVID-19 equity: Members commit to ensuring that testing for COVID-19 is available and accessible in minority communities and that new treatments are distributed and used equitably as they become available. Members will also work for prioritization of vaccinations for those individuals and families at higher risk — elder populations and communities of color, including Native American communities.

Enact change across our own health systems: Members are examining how their organizations recruit, hire, promote and retain employees; how they conduct business operations, including visible diversity and inclusivity at the decision, leadership and governance levels; and how they incentivize and hold our leaders accountable.

Advocate for improved health outcomes for minority communities and populations: Members agree to promote and improve the delivery of culturally competent care and oppose policies that exacerbate or perpetuate economic and social inequities, including such issues as education, housing and criminal justice reform.

Strengthen trust with minority communities: Members will continue to foster, strengthen and sustain authentic relationships based on mutually agreed goals to better understand the unique needs of their communities.

Kaiser and other Catholic health care leaders who have signed the pledge recognize that collectively they are in a unique position to bring about overdue change to policies and practices that have allowed systemic racism and health disparities to continue in the United States.

To hold itself and its members accountable, CHA intends to provide updates on the commitment progress annually.
